Output f3401183af3b91e80537784a3a78e261ce80ce5369dd5394883399ba5c0d3f32:2

value
18704816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be336b8c7a5596e88e7fca81e78b0d40c443b6c3 OP_EQUAL
address
MRErDcLJVEHaCBRv948aG4wi4cfoJDjAv6
transaction
f3401183af3b91e80537784a3a78e261ce80ce5369dd5394883399ba5c0d3f32
spent
true